《數(shù)控機(jī)床改造設(shè)計(jì)分析》由會(huì)員分享,可在線閱讀,更多相關(guān)《數(shù)控機(jī)床改造設(shè)計(jì)分析(3頁珍藏版)》請?jiān)谘b配圖網(wǎng)上搜索。
1、數(shù)控機(jī)床改造設(shè)計(jì)分析
第一章概述
機(jī)床作為機(jī)械制造業(yè)的重要基礎(chǔ)裝備,它的發(fā)展一直引起人們的關(guān)注,由于計(jì)算機(jī)技術(shù)的興起,促使機(jī)床的控制信息出現(xiàn)了質(zhì)的突破,導(dǎo)致了應(yīng)用數(shù)字化技術(shù)進(jìn)行柔性自動(dòng)化控制的新一代機(jī)床-數(shù)控機(jī)床的誕生和發(fā)展。計(jì)算機(jī)的出現(xiàn)和應(yīng)用,為人類提供了實(shí)現(xiàn)機(jī)械加工工藝過程自動(dòng)化的理想手段。隨著計(jì)算機(jī)的發(fā)展,數(shù)控機(jī)床也得到迅速的發(fā)展和廣泛的應(yīng)用,同時(shí)使人們對傳統(tǒng)的機(jī)床傳動(dòng)及結(jié)構(gòu)的概念發(fā)生了根本的轉(zhuǎn)變。數(shù)控機(jī)床以其優(yōu)異的性能和精度、靈捷而多樣化的功能引起世人矚目,并開創(chuàng)機(jī)械產(chǎn)品向機(jī)電一體化發(fā)展的先河。數(shù)控機(jī)床是以數(shù)字化的信息實(shí)現(xiàn)機(jī)床控制的機(jī)電一體化產(chǎn)品,它把刀具和工件之間的相對位置,機(jī)床
2、電機(jī)的啟動(dòng)和停止,主軸變速,工件松開和夾緊,刀具的選擇,冷卻泵的起停等各種操作和順序動(dòng)作等信息用代碼化的數(shù)字記錄在控制介質(zhì)上,然后將數(shù)字信息送入數(shù)控裝置或計(jì)算機(jī),經(jīng)過譯碼,運(yùn)算,發(fā)出各種指令控制機(jī)床伺服系統(tǒng)或其它的執(zhí)行元件,加工出所需的工件。數(shù)控機(jī)床與普通機(jī)床相比,其主要有以下的優(yōu)點(diǎn):1.適應(yīng)性強(qiáng),適合加工單件或小批量的復(fù)雜工件;在數(shù)控機(jī)床上改變加工工件時(shí),只需重新編制新工件的加工程序,就能實(shí)現(xiàn)新工件加工。2.加工精度高;3.生產(chǎn)效率高;4.減輕勞動(dòng)強(qiáng)度,改善勞動(dòng)條件;5.良好的經(jīng)濟(jì)效益;6.有利于生產(chǎn)管理的現(xiàn)代化。數(shù)控機(jī)床已成為我國市場需求的主流產(chǎn)品,需求量逐年激增。我國數(shù)控機(jī)機(jī)床近幾年在產(chǎn)
3、業(yè)化和產(chǎn)品開發(fā)上取得了明顯的進(jìn)步,特別是在機(jī)床的高速化、多軸化、復(fù)合化、精密化方面進(jìn)步很大。但是,國產(chǎn)數(shù)控機(jī)床與先進(jìn)國家的同類產(chǎn)品相比,還存在差距,還不能滿足國家建設(shè)的需要。我國是一個(gè)機(jī)床大國,有三百多萬臺(tái)普通機(jī)床。但機(jī)床的素質(zhì)差,性能落后,單臺(tái)機(jī)床的平均產(chǎn)值只有先進(jìn)工業(yè)國家的1/10左右,差距太大,急待改造。舊機(jī)床的數(shù)控化改造,顧名思義就是在普通機(jī)床上增加微機(jī)控制裝置,使其具有一定的自動(dòng)化能力,以實(shí)現(xiàn)預(yù)定的加工工藝目標(biāo)。隨著數(shù)控機(jī)床越來越多的普及應(yīng)用,數(shù)控機(jī)床的技術(shù)經(jīng)濟(jì)效益為大家所理解。在國內(nèi)工廠的技術(shù)改造中,機(jī)床的微機(jī)數(shù)控化改造已成為重要方面。許多工廠一面購置數(shù)控機(jī)床一面利用數(shù)控、數(shù)顯、P
4、C技術(shù)改造普通機(jī)床,并取得了良好的經(jīng)濟(jì)效益。我國經(jīng)濟(jì)資源有限,國家大,機(jī)床需要量大,因此不可能拿出相當(dāng)大的資金去購買新型的數(shù)控機(jī)床,而我國的舊機(jī)床很多,用經(jīng)濟(jì)型數(shù)控系統(tǒng)改造普通機(jī)床,在投資少的情況下,使其既能滿足加工的需要,又能提高機(jī)床的自動(dòng)化程度,比較符合我國的國情。1984年,我國開始生產(chǎn)經(jīng)濟(jì)型數(shù)控系統(tǒng),并用于改造舊機(jī)床。到目前為止,已有很多廠家生產(chǎn)經(jīng)濟(jì)型數(shù)控系統(tǒng)??梢灶A(yù)料,今后,機(jī)床的經(jīng)濟(jì)型數(shù)控化改造將迅速發(fā)展和普及。所以說,本畢業(yè)設(shè)計(jì)實(shí)例具有典型性和實(shí)用性。
第二章總體方案的設(shè)計(jì)
2.1設(shè)計(jì)任務(wù)本設(shè)計(jì)任務(wù)是對CA6140普通車床進(jìn)行數(shù)控改造。利用微機(jī)對縱、橫向進(jìn)給系統(tǒng)進(jìn)行開環(huán)控制,
5、縱向(Z向)脈沖當(dāng)量為0.01mm/脈沖,橫向(X向)脈沖當(dāng)量為0.005mm/脈沖,驅(qū)動(dòng)元件采用步進(jìn)電機(jī),傳動(dòng)系統(tǒng)采用滾珠絲杠副,刀架采用自動(dòng)轉(zhuǎn)位刀架。2.2總體方案的論證對于普通機(jī)床的經(jīng)濟(jì)型數(shù)控改造,在確定總體設(shè)計(jì)方案時(shí),應(yīng)考慮在滿足設(shè)計(jì)要求的前提下,對機(jī)床的改動(dòng)應(yīng)盡可能少,以降低成本。(1)數(shù)控系統(tǒng)運(yùn)動(dòng)方式的確定數(shù)控系統(tǒng)按運(yùn)動(dòng)方式可分為點(diǎn)位控制系統(tǒng)、點(diǎn)位直線控制系統(tǒng)、連續(xù)控制系統(tǒng)。由于要求CA6140車床加工復(fù)雜輪廓零件,所以本微機(jī)數(shù)控系統(tǒng)采用兩軸聯(lián)動(dòng)連續(xù)控制系統(tǒng)。(2)伺服進(jìn)給系統(tǒng)的改造設(shè)計(jì)數(shù)控機(jī)床的伺服進(jìn)給系統(tǒng)有開環(huán)、半閉環(huán)和閉環(huán)之分。因?yàn)殚_環(huán)控制具有結(jié)構(gòu)簡單、設(shè)計(jì)制造容易、控制精度
6、較好、容易調(diào)試、價(jià)格便宜、使用維修方便等優(yōu)點(diǎn)。所以,本設(shè)計(jì)決定采用開環(huán)控制系統(tǒng)。(3)數(shù)控系統(tǒng)的硬件電路設(shè)計(jì)任何一個(gè)數(shù)控系統(tǒng)都由硬件和軟件兩部分組成。硬件是數(shù)控系統(tǒng)的基礎(chǔ),性能的好壞直接影響整體數(shù)控系統(tǒng)的工作性能。有了硬件,軟件才能有效地運(yùn)行。在設(shè)計(jì)的數(shù)控裝置中,CPU的選擇是關(guān)鍵,選擇CPU應(yīng)考慮以下要素:1.時(shí)鐘頻率和字長與被控對象的運(yùn)動(dòng)速度和精度密切相關(guān);2.可擴(kuò)展存儲(chǔ)器的容量與數(shù)控功能的強(qiáng)弱相關(guān);3.I/O口擴(kuò)展的能力與對外設(shè)控制的能力相關(guān)。除此之外,還應(yīng)根據(jù)數(shù)控系統(tǒng)的應(yīng)用場合、控制對象以及各種性能、參數(shù)要求等,綜合起來考慮以確定CPU。在我國,普通機(jī)床數(shù)控改造方面應(yīng)用較普遍的是Z80
7、CPU和MCS-51系列單片機(jī),主要是因?yàn)樗鼈兊呐涮仔酒阋耍占靶?、通用性?qiáng),制造和維修方便,完全能滿足經(jīng)濟(jì)型數(shù)控機(jī)床的改造需要。本設(shè)計(jì)中是以MCS-51系列單片機(jī),51系列相對48系列指令更豐富,相對96系列價(jià)格更便宜,51系列中,是無ROM的8051,8751是用EPROM代替ROM的8051。目前,工控機(jī)中應(yīng)用最多的是8031單片機(jī)。本設(shè)計(jì)以8031芯片為核心,增加存儲(chǔ)器擴(kuò)展電路、接口和面板操作開關(guān)組成的控制系統(tǒng)。2.3總體方案的確定經(jīng)總體設(shè)計(jì)方案的論證后,確定的CA6140車床經(jīng)濟(jì)型數(shù)控改造示意圖如圖所示。CA6140車床的主軸轉(zhuǎn)速部分保留原機(jī)床的功能,即手動(dòng)變速。車床的縱向(Z軸)
8、和橫向(X軸)進(jìn)給運(yùn)動(dòng)采用步進(jìn)電機(jī)驅(qū)動(dòng)。由8031單片機(jī)組成微機(jī)作為數(shù)控裝置的核心,由I/O接口、環(huán)形分配器與功率放大器一起控制步進(jìn)電機(jī)轉(zhuǎn)動(dòng),經(jīng)齒輪減速后帶動(dòng)滾珠絲杠轉(zhuǎn)動(dòng),從而實(shí)現(xiàn)車床的縱向、橫向進(jìn)給運(yùn)動(dòng)。刀架改成由微機(jī)控制的經(jīng)電機(jī)驅(qū)動(dòng)的自動(dòng)控制的自動(dòng)轉(zhuǎn)位刀架。為保持切削螺紋的功能,必須安裝主軸脈沖發(fā)生器,為此采用主軸靠同步齒形帶使脈沖發(fā)生器同步旋轉(zhuǎn),發(fā)出兩路信號(hào):每轉(zhuǎn)發(fā)出的脈沖個(gè)數(shù)和一個(gè)同步信號(hào),經(jīng)隔離電路以及I/O接口送給微機(jī)。如圖2-1所示:
第三章微機(jī)數(shù)控系統(tǒng)硬件電路設(shè)計(jì)
3.1微機(jī)數(shù)控系統(tǒng)硬件電路總體方案設(shè)計(jì)本系統(tǒng)選用8031CPU作為數(shù)控系統(tǒng)的中央處理機(jī)。外接一片2764EPR
9、OM,作為監(jiān)控程序的程序存儲(chǔ)器和存放常用零件的加工程序。再選用一片6264RAM用于存放需要隨機(jī)修改的零件程序、工作參數(shù)。采用譯碼法對擴(kuò)展芯片進(jìn)行尋址,采用74LS138譯碼器完成此功能。8279作為系統(tǒng)的輸入輸出口擴(kuò)展,分別接鍵盤的輸入、輸出顯示,8255接步進(jìn)電機(jī)的環(huán)形分配器,分別并行控制X軸和Z軸的步進(jìn)電機(jī)。另外,還要考慮機(jī)床與單片機(jī)之間的光電隔離,功率放大電路等。其硬件框圖如圖3-1所示:圖3-28031芯片內(nèi)部結(jié)構(gòu)圖各引腳功能簡要介紹如下:⒈源引腳VSS:電源接地端。VCC:+5V電源端。⒉輸入/輸出(I/O)口線8031單片機(jī)有P0、P1、P2、P34個(gè)端口,每個(gè)端口8根I/O線。
10、當(dāng)系統(tǒng)擴(kuò)展外部存儲(chǔ)器時(shí),P0口用來輸出低8位并行數(shù)據(jù),P2口用來輸出高8位地址,P3口除可作為一個(gè)8位準(zhǔn)雙向并行口外,還具有第二功能,各引腳第二功能定義如下:P3.0RXD:串行數(shù)據(jù)輸入端。P3.1TXD:串行數(shù)據(jù)輸出端P3.2INT0:外部中斷0請求信號(hào)輸入端。P3.3INT1:外部中斷1請求信號(hào)輸入端。P3.4T0:定時(shí)器/計(jì)數(shù)器0外部輸入端P3.5T1:定時(shí)器/計(jì)數(shù)器1外部輸入端P3.6WR:外部數(shù)據(jù)存儲(chǔ)器寫選通。P3.7RD:外部數(shù)據(jù)存儲(chǔ)器讀選通。在進(jìn)行第二功能操作前,對第二功能的輸出鎖存器必須由程序置1。⒊信號(hào)控制線RST/VPD:RST為復(fù)位信號(hào)線輸入引腳,在時(shí)鐘電路工作以后,該引
11、腳上出現(xiàn)兩個(gè)機(jī)器周期以上的高電平,完成一次復(fù)位操作。8031單片機(jī)采用兩種復(fù)位方式:一種是加電自動(dòng)復(fù)位,另一種為開關(guān)復(fù)位。ALE/PROG:ALE是地址鎖存允許信號(hào)。它的作用是把CPU從P0口分時(shí)送出的低8位地址鎖存在一個(gè)外加的鎖存器中。外部程序存儲(chǔ)器讀選通信號(hào)。當(dāng)其為低電平時(shí)有效。
參考文獻(xiàn):
【2】李華,MCS-51單片機(jī)實(shí)用接口技術(shù).北京:北京航空航天大學(xué)出版社,1993
【3】李圣怡等,Windows環(huán)境下軟硬件接口設(shè)計(jì).長沙:國防科技大學(xué)出版社,2001
【4】顧京,數(shù)控加工編程及操作.北京:高等教育出版社,2002
【5】周偉平,機(jī)械制造技術(shù).武漢:華中科技大學(xué)出版社,2002
【6】劉迎春,MCS-51單片機(jī)原理及應(yīng)用教程.北京:清華大學(xué)出版社,2005
摘要:針對現(xiàn)有常規(guī)CA6140普遍車床的缺點(diǎn)提出數(shù)控改裝方案和單片機(jī)系統(tǒng)設(shè)計(jì),提高加工精度和擴(kuò)大機(jī)床使用范圍,并提高生產(chǎn)率。本論文說明了普通車床的數(shù)控化改造的設(shè)計(jì)過程,較詳盡地介紹了CA6140機(jī)械改造部分的設(shè)計(jì)及數(shù)控系統(tǒng)部分的設(shè)計(jì)。采用以8031為CPU的控制系統(tǒng)對信號(hào)進(jìn)行處理,由I/O接口輸出步進(jìn)脈沖,經(jīng)一級(jí)齒輪傳動(dòng)減速后,帶動(dòng)滾動(dòng)絲杠轉(zhuǎn)動(dòng),從而實(shí)現(xiàn)縱向、橫向的進(jìn)給運(yùn)動(dòng)。
關(guān)鍵詞:數(shù)控機(jī)床,單片機(jī)數(shù)控系統(tǒng),改裝設(shè)計(jì)